Gas chromatographic determination of noxyptyline in substance, tablets and in biological material.

Abstract

Noxyptyline, i.e. 5-(2-dimethylaminoethyloxyimine)-5H-dibenzo[a,b] cyclohepta-1,4-diene hydrochloride, is an antidepressant. A new, direct method for its determination in substance and in tablets by means of gas chromatography has been developed. The results were compared with those of the spectrophotometric method, and the systematic errors(coefficient of variation) were 2.19% and 2.49%, respectively. Appropriate conditions were developed for the extraction of noxyptyline from plasma and urine, and the gas chromatographic method was applied for its determination. Within the concentration range 0.5-10 microgram/cm3, the systematic error after extraction from plasma was 4.61%, and after extraction from urine it was 2.08%. The recovery from plasma was 71.12 +/- 8%, and from urine it was 90.94 +/- 1.5%.
